I want to pull the pin to high from an external board, do i need a resistor between the pin and 3.3V or is there one built in the chip

  • In theory you don't need the resistor, but if you ever configure the pin as output-low you'll set up a very low-impedance  current path into the pin, which could damage something. There are internal pullup/down resistors, but they don't really help this case.

    Since I make mistakes all the time, I typically design in the resistor (sized according to the expected EMI environment).
